The regional market outside of Campeche was where all the Mayan farmers brought their food, some had pretty bit stalls of vegetables, meat or fish, others just brought up 5 or 6 live Turkeys to be sold for Chirstmas. One lady was selling about 2 dozen honey cakes that caught Miles’ attention. She was nice enough to let us take her photo
